Key Facts
- Negative elongation factor E Dmel_CG5994's instance of is recorded as protein[2].
- Negative elongation factor E Dmel_CG5994's UniProt protein ID is recorded as P92204[3].
- Negative elongation factor E Dmel_CG5994's part of is recorded as RNA-binding domain superfamily[4].
- Negative elongation factor E Dmel_CG5994's part of is recorded as Negative elongation factor E[5].
- Negative elongation factor E Dmel_CG5994's part of is recorded as Nucleotide-binding alpha-beta plait domain superfamily[6].
- Negative elongation factor E Dmel_CG5994's part of is recorded as Negative elongation factor E, RNA recognition motif, protein family[7].
- Negative elongation factor E Dmel_CG5994's part of is recorded as RNA recognition motif domain, protein family[8].
- Negative elongation factor E Dmel_CG5994's has part is recorded as Negative elongation factor E, RNA recognition motif[9].
- Negative elongation factor E Dmel_CG5994's has part is recorded as RNA recognition motif domain[10].
- Negative elongation factor E Dmel_CG5994's RefSeq protein ID is recorded as NP_648241[11].
- Negative elongation factor E Dmel_CG5994's molecular function is recorded as nucleic acid binding[12].
- Negative elongation factor E Dmel_CG5994's molecular function is recorded as RNA binding[13].
- Negative elongation factor E Dmel_CG5994's molecular function is recorded as mRNA binding[14].
- Negative elongation factor E Dmel_CG5994's molecular function is recorded as protein binding[15].
- Negative elongation factor E Dmel_CG5994's cell component is recorded as nucleus[16].
- Negative elongation factor E Dmel_CG5994's cell component is recorded as chromosome[17].
- Negative elongation factor E Dmel_CG5994's cell component is recorded as transcription elongation factor complex[18].
- Negative elongation factor E Dmel_CG5994's cell component is recorded as transcription repressor complex[19].
- Negative elongation factor E Dmel_CG5994's cell component is recorded as NELF complex[20].
- Negative elongation factor E Dmel_CG5994's cell component is recorded as NELF complex[21].
- Negative elongation factor E Dmel_CG5994's biological process is recorded as transcription, DNA-templated[22].
- Negative elongation factor E Dmel_CG5994's biological process is recorded as regulation of transcription, DNA-templated[23].
- Negative elongation factor E Dmel_CG5994's biological process is recorded as transcription elongation from RNA polymerase II promoter[24].
- Negative elongation factor E Dmel_CG5994's biological process is recorded as negative regulation of DNA-templated transcription, elongation[25].
- Negative elongation factor E Dmel_CG5994's biological process is recorded as negative regulation of transcription elongation from RNA polymerase II promoter[26].
